WebHigh phosphorus levels can cause damage to your body. Extra phosphorus causes body changes that pull calcium out of your bones, making them weak. High phosphorus and calcium levels also lead to dangerous calcium deposits in blood vessels, lungs, eyes, and heart. Over time this can lead to increased risk of heart attack, stroke or death. WebJul 16, 2024 · Calcium/Phosphate precipitation. 25 mMol/L of phos + Calcium 10mEq/L + 6% amino acids is the maximum. Less than 6% amino acids will increase risk of precipitation. Sodium. 90% of sodium acetate is converted to sodium bicarbonate. 70 mEq/L of sodium chloride will generally keep patients normonatremic if they are at goal when initiated on PN

ACTIONS: highly … WebJun 21, 2024 · Phosphate is predominantly an intracellular anion. The normal plasma inorganic phosphate (Pi )concentration in an adult is 2.5 to 4.5 mg/dl, and men have a slightly higher concentration than women. In children, the normal range is 4 to 7 mg/dl. WebAug 1, 2024 · Absorption of dietary phosphorus occurs mainly in the jejunum. It is mediated by both a paracellular sodium-independent pathway (driven by high intraluminal phosphorus content) and by active sodium-dependent co-transporters. WebNeutra-Phos K® contains 14.25 mEq of potassium per 8 mmoles of phospho-rus, while K-Phos Neutral® only has 1.1 mEq of potassium per 8 mmoles of phosphorus. The names may be confus-ing, but K-Phos Neutral® in NOT a good potassium supplement; it is a good oral solid phosphorus supplement. WebPotassium phosphate/sodium phosphate is a medication used for people with high urinary pH. It makes the urine more acidic. This is helpful for preventing kidney stones, as well as preventing odor and rash caused by urine that contains too much ammonia.
